- Description
This dataset contains visitor management zones (VMZ) for public conservation land, as defined in the Conservation Management Strategy documents since 2012. The zones attribute public conservation land with a ‘recreation class’ that defines the type of experience the topography and accessibility imply. The visitor management zones are defined for...
